On today’s Midday Report with host Brian Venua: Dillingham police set off explosives at the city’s landfill with help from the FBI. Alaska Public Media’s Jeremy Hsieh investigates who’s behind ads attacking Anchorage Mayor Dave Bronson. KRBD’s Jack Darrell reports on the indigenous knowledge being incorporated into federal policy on Alexander Archipelago wolves.
